Hello,

set the local resp to "$var(resp)" or another writable Kamailio config
variable name.

On 14.08.24 11:31, 17603019528--- via sr-users wrote:
> ALL:
>     Hi, here is my lua script:
>      ```
>      local body = '{"ip":"172.16.4.111", "ports":[5261, 5260]}'
>      local resp = ""
>      local code = KSR.http_client.curl_connect_post("configapi", "", 
> "application/json", body, resp)
>     ```
>    the error is :
>    ```
>    24(2406) DEBUG: app_lua [app_lua_api.c:1024]: sr_kemi_lua_exec_func_ex(): 
> param[0] for: curl_connect_post is str: configapi
>   24(2406) DEBUG: app_lua [app_lua_api.c:1024]: sr_kemi_lua_exec_func_ex(): 
> param[1] for: curl_connect_post is str: 
>   24(2406) DEBUG: app_lua [app_lua_api.c:1024]: sr_kemi_lua_exec_func_ex(): 
> param[2] for: curl_connect_post is str: application/json
>   24(2406) DEBUG: app_lua [app_lua_api.c:1024]: sr_kemi_lua_exec_func_ex(): 
> param[3] for: curl_connect_post is str: {"ip":"172.16.4.111", "ports":[5261, 
> 5260]}
>   24(2406) DEBUG: app_lua [app_lua_api.c:1024]: sr_kemi_lua_exec_func_ex(): 
> param[4] for: curl_connect_post is str: 
>   24(2406) ERROR: <core> [core/pvapi.c:429]: pv_cache_get(): invalid 
> parameters
>   24(2406) ERROR: http_client [http_client.c:739]: ki_curl_connect_post(): 
> failed to get pv spec for: 
>    ```
>   I know the error means: "resp" type is not right,  what is  the correct 
> type ?  I search google for this issue, no one knows,  someone  please help 
> me.
